Evacuable Briquetting Dies

Stainless Steel Dies for Spectropress® Laboratory Presses

Stainless steel die sets offer the option of evacuation in briquetting powdered samples for XRF sample analysis. The sidearm permits attachment of a vacuum hose.

The dies are fabricated from stainless steel and precision ground to close tolerances to ensure precision fit of the stainless pellets supplied with the die or optionally available tungsten carbide pellets. Additionally, close tolerance manufacturing ensures that tapered compressible aluminum PelletCupsTM precisely fit into the bore of the die with just enough room for the pellets containing a powered sample substance to gently fall to the bottom on a cushion of air. This reduces the likelihood of sample particles becoming entrapped in between the steel pellets and inside bore diameter and minimizes the potential threat of die scoring.

Usable with Automatic Standard 30 Ton and Manual 12 Ton SpectroPresses, in addition to other laboratory presses. Consists of: base, main cylindrical body, two optically polished stainless steel pellets, plunger, collection up and “O” rings. Maximum force indicated on each die set.

Note: For best results and close tolerances, use with Chemplex Compressible aluminum and plastic PelletCupsTM

Pelletaid® Sample Pellet Release Agent and Stainless Steel Die Conditioner

A simple "dusting" application to the metal pellet included with a die set prevents the sample from sticking. Consisting of a lubricious organic substance, PelletAid does not introduce unwanted analyte-lines. When sparingly applied to the inside walls of a die set, movement of the pellets and plunger is greatly facilitated. PelletAid has an unusual affinity to adhere to metal components and serves as a dry focused lubricant. Contains: 70.6% C, 11.5% H, 10.4% O and 7.5% Na.
